ive recently come by what sounds like a good deal on a slightly used tec 3 engine management system any positives or negatives on this system that anyones heard of does anyone even use them on 4g63's the guy says the computer is a plug and play type thing but from what ive seen theyre all universal ecus
 
They are universal it will not plug into your harness in any way. You'll need a wiring harness,all sensors are GM,and an ignition system. I have all TEC3 stuff on my car and none of it is original. It's a great system(once it's tuned)but it is trickey to get it tuned. I'm close but still not there yet.
